The error is detected if USART1 TX configured to PA9 and RX to PA10.
The serial cable removal stops the USB communication.
In case of VBUS sensing deactivation, erroneously
both USB_OTG_GCCFG_VBUSBSEN and
USB_OTG_GCCFG_NOVBUSSENS are set in GCCFG.
Correct handling is:
- VBUS sensing deactivation: set USB_OTG_GCCFG_NOVBUSSENS in GCCFG.
- VBUS sensing activation: set USB_OTG_GCCFG_VBUSBSEN in GCCFG.
ST Bug Tracker ID: 34714

The STM32L4x2 SoCs need to control the isolation of the USB features
from VDDUSB. This is done through the PWR_CR2 bit USV. The STM32L4 HAL
in stm32l4xx_ll_pwr.h wrongly checks for the PWR_CR2_PVME1 bit, which
is only available on Cat. 3 devices. Replace the check by PWR_CR2_USV
like it is already done in stm32l4xx_hal_pwr_ex.c.

In order to ease the usage of its sensors, STMicroelectronics provides
some generic libraries. The first sensor to use that is vl53l0x time of
flight sensor. I have made the implementation generic enough to add some
more libraries in the future.
All the libraries will be located in ext/hal/st/lib.
The vl53l0X library is made of 2 parts :
* the core, that is generic to all platforms
* the platform, contains the adaptation layer. This will be
implemented in driver as it is Zephyr specific.
